Beijing – Xiaomi is poised to unveil its highly anticipated SU7 Ultra electric vehicle, signaling a major push into the premium automotive market. In a recent Q&A session (the 108th edition, to be exact), Xiaomi addressed key questions surrounding the SU7 Ultra, hinting at diverse configurations and reaffirming its readiness for a swift rollout.
The official launch event, scheduled for February 27th at 19:00, will not only showcase the SU7 Ultra but also the Xiaomi 15 Ultra smartphone. The company is framing this event as a culmination of five years of high-end exploration and a bold step into the ultra-premium segment. The launch will be broadcast across multiple platforms, including Xiaomi’s official accounts, digital media outlets, automotive news channels, and e-commerce platforms.
Strategic Closure of Pre-Order Channel
Xiaomi plans to temporarily close the pre-order channel (referred to as 小订 or small order in Chinese) at the start of the launch event. This strategic move aims to solidify the delivery rights of existing pre-order customers and prepare the system for the official order placement and configuration locking process that will follow the unveiling. Customers who place a pre-order with a 10,000 RMB deposit before the February 27th deadline will retain priority delivery rights.
For potential buyers eager to experience the SU7 Ultra firsthand, Xiaomi has already deployed static displays in 131 stores across 43 cities nationwide. This allows customers to get an up-close look at the vehicle’s design and features before committing to a purchase.
Multiple Versions to Cater to Diverse Needs
Addressing speculation about different SU7 Ultra versions, Xiaomi confirmed that it will offer a range of options to cater to diverse customer preferences. The SU7 Ultra is positioned as a new luxury car, aiming to excel in design, technology, and sporty performance. While performance is a key aspect, Xiaomi emphasizes that the SU7 Ultra offers a holistic package of luxury and innovation. The specific details of these different versions will be revealed at the launch event.
Ready for Rapid Delivery
Xiaomi expressed confidence in its ability to deliver the SU7 Ultra to customers quickly after its official launch. The company stated that it is fully prepared for mass production and distribution, aiming to exceed customer expectations with a comprehensive and high-quality product.
